Welcome
Thank you for purchasing the Genmitsu 3018-PROVer CNC Router from SainSmart.
Included in your package will be a SD card. SD card or both depending on the specific package you purchased.
These contain:
• Instructional videos
• Manuals and diagrams
• Windows USB Driver
• GrblControl/Candle operating software for Windows
• Sample files
• Offline Controller control files
These files can also be downloaded from the SainSmart Wiki Page http://wiki.sainsmart.com/index.php/101-60-3018PROVER which
also contains some extra files such as wiring diagrams and Laser connections.
Before attempting to assembly the 3018 PROVer, please watch the assembly video on the SD card that came with your machine.
This will save time and avoid mistakes.

Warnings
As with any power tool it is essential you take proper precautions and care in its use.
Proper care and use includes but is not limited to
Any modification of the Router or the use of accessories provided by a third party will void any warranty.
SainSmart does not accept any responsibility or liability for any use or misuse of the Router including any accessories.
• Follow all instructions carefully
• Wear appropriate eye protection
• Depending in the materials being cut make sure the Router is in a well ventilated area and appropriate breathing
protection is used
• Take extra precautions for any material which may produce harmful dust or fumes
• Ensure the Emergency stop button is easily accessible at all times
• Do not leave the Router unattended while it is operating
• Use this CNC router under adult supervision if you are underage

Finishing the Assembly
Install the Gantry assembly onto the Base Assembly
NAME BEFOREQTY.CODE
AFTER
Base assembly
Gantry assembly
Bolt M5*14
VER-2
VER-1
VER-42
1
1
12
Gantry Alignment Tool & Allen Key (4mm)
Parts
Used
Tools
Steps
VER-42 x12Pcs
This is a critical part of the assembly, at the end of this the gantry assembly should be vertical
to the bed on the base assembly and in line with it horizontally. It’s worth taking the extra few
minutes to get this right!
A. Put the base assembly on its feet bed on a flat surface. B. Slide the gantry over the sides
of the Base assembly (It’s a tight fit). C. Adjust the gantry position so the holes in the gantry
uprights are over the threaded holes in the slider nuts on each side of the base. D. Place the
Gantry Alignment Tool under one of the gantries. E. Press the gantry down so it is evenly
touching the top of the Alignment tool, the holes should still be aligned over the nuts.
F. Insert the nuts and finger tighten. (Repeat for the other side.)
Place the long edge of the Gantry Alignment Tool into the slots between the gantry upright and the back of the base frame, it should just fit in both!
NOTE: Use the Gantry Alignment tool to make sure the distance from the edge of Gantry assembly at the back to the inside of the rear frame should
be 31.5mm. (Repeat for the other side.)
If there is any movement of the Gantry Alignment Tool between the Gantry and the inside of the back frame slacken the bolts and adjust the position
of the gantry, recheck and retighten after also placing the Gantry adjustment tool under the gantry and rechecking that it touches along its length.
Finally tighten all 12 bolts, quite firmly, but only using the Allen key provided. Check that all the bolts securing the stepper motor and the guide rods are tight.

Finishing the Assembly
Install the Spindle Motor
NAME BEFOREQTY.CODE
Loosen the M4 Clamping bolt on the spindle mount.
Slide the spindle motor into the mount from the top.
NOTE: This can be a very tight fit especially at first.
If it won’t fit very gently prise open the slot in the motor
mount using a wide bladed screwdriver or something
similar until it fits.
Align the top of the sleeve round the motor to the top
of the spindle mount.
Tighten the clamping bolt, do not over tighten!

Finishing the Assembly
Install the Motherboard
NAME BEFOREQTY.CODE
Place the bolts into the holes on the motherboard back
plate and screw the T Nuts on to the end of the bolt
with the flat/stepped edge towards the motherboard.
Align the T nuts with the channel and press them in.
Slide the Motherboard so the distance between the
edge of the back plate and the outer edge of the
gantry is 30mm.
Tighten (Do not over tighten) the bolts, as you do this
the T nuts should turn to be vertical in the slots holding
it in place.
